Understanding Web Development Workflows

What is a Web Development Workflow?

Definition and Components

A web development workflow involves a series of well-defined stages that guide the entire process of creating a website or web application. It typically includes tasks such as:

  • Planning
  • Design
  • Development
  • Testing
  • Deployment
  • Maintenance

These stages help ensure that every part of the development cycle is organized and efficient.

Benefits of Having a Structured Workflow

Having a structured workflow improves focus and consistency. It helps manage project timelines, reduces errors, and facilitates efficient teamwork. Incorporating tools and strategies for a smarter web development workflow not only lowers stress but also improves project outcomes.

Key Phases in a Workflow

Planning and Requirements Gathering

Planning is crucial. It involves understanding the project’s scope and gathering detailed requirements. Using project management tools like TrelloAsana, or Monday.com helps in tracking progress and assigning tasks.

Design and Prototyping

Designers move from wireframes to prototypes at this stage. Tools like Figma and Sketch are extensively used. They allow collaborative design, making it easier to share ideas and iterations quickly.

Development and Testing

Development covers both front-end and back-end tasks. Using code editors like VS Code and Sublime Text is common. Version control systems like Git ensure code integrity. Automated testing tools help catch bugs early, ensuring a more stable product.

Deployment and Maintenance

The final stages involve deploying the site using platforms like Heroku or AWS, followed by regular maintenance to ensure everything runs smoothly. Continuous integration and deployment tools like Jenkins facilitate hassle-free updates and quick bug fixes.

Version Control Systems

Importance of Version Control in Workflows

Version control is non-negotiable. It tracks changes, helps in collaboration, and saves you from the “it worked yesterday” conundrum.

Overview of Git and GitHub/GitLab

Git is the backbone. Pair it with GitHub or GitLab for repositories, issue tracking, and continuous integration. This combo keeps the project under control.

Code Editors and Integrated Development Environments (IDEs)

Popular Code Editors (e.g., VS Code, Sublime Text)

Code editors like VS Code and Sublime Text are essentials. They’re lightweight, customizable, and perfect for editing everything from HTML to JavaScript.

IDEs for Comprehensive Development Needs

When you need more, go for IDEs like IntelliJ IDEA or Eclipse. They offer debugging tools, version control integration, and advanced code navigation.

Automation Tools

Tools for Task Automation (e.g., Gulp, Grunt)

Automation tools like Gulp and Grunt take care of repetitive tasks. They compile code, optimize images, and run tests, ensuring smoother workflows.

Benefits of Automating Repetitive Tasks

Automating these tasks saves time and reduces errors. It lets you focus on the creative aspects, rather than mundane processes.

Continuous Integration and Deployment (CI/CD)

Benefits of CI/CD in Maintaining Smooth Workflows

CI/CD ensures that changes are integrated regularly and deployments are smooth. It reduces the risk of last-minute failures. Jenkins and CircleCI automate these tasks, ensuring a stable pipeline.

Tools for Automating Testing and Deployment (e.g., Jenkins, CircleCI)

Automate testing and deployment. This catches issues early and speeds up the release cycle. Use JenkinsTravis CI, or CircleCI for these purposes. They make integrating new code a non-event.
